Output 8d07c87b6ebac173574d113afe03bd2832572adb2c1ead375723e016e635d154:80

value
306450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ee6ecca0c0c3dc5d431b123f8ae69cb167f4370 OP_EQUAL
address
3BoQtbKKJt8HzGVaJnhE7pf5DwaGmUrkjn
transaction
8d07c87b6ebac173574d113afe03bd2832572adb2c1ead375723e016e635d154
confirmations
237612
spent
true